(West Chester, PA – December 14, 2021): On March 1 during the monthly Council of Organizations, SGA held the Executive Board Debates for the candidates to answer questions and introduce themselves to the student body. Following the debates, the voting period opened from March 2 to March 4, giving students the opportunity to vote on D2L for the candidates. After the votes were counted, the 2022-2023 Executive Board was decided, resulting in an executive board elect made up entirely of women. 

 

President – Catherine Young

Catherine is a third-year Marketing major with minors in Nutrition, Digital Marketing, and Entrepreneurship from Yardley, PA. She currently serves as the inaugural Public Relations Officer on the Executive Board and has previously held the positions of Dining Services Senator and Sustainability Senator. Catherine is a member of the Abbe Society, Phi Sigma Pi National Honor Fraternity, Mu Kappa Tau Marketing Honors Society, and Omicron Delta Kappa Leadership Honors Society.

 

Vice President – Karen Mercy

Karen is a third-year French and English major with minors in Creative Writing and Linguistics. Originally from West Chester, PA, Karen has previously held the position of Parking & Public Safety, University Libraries, and The College of Arts & Humanities Senator. Karen is also a member of Phi Sigma Pi National Honor Fraternity. 

 

Secretary – Sierra Irving

Sierra is a second-year Computer Science major with a minor in Women & Gender Studies. Sierra joined the Senate in her first year and was previously the Public Relations and Technology Senator. From Nazareth, PA, she is also actively involved on campus in A Moment of Magic, Italian Club, Women in Computer Science, and the Golden Ram Society.

 

Treasurer – Kate Spaulding

Kate is a third-year International Relations major with minors in Japanese, Global Studies, and Global Awareness from Downingtown, PA. She currently serves as the Career Development Senator and has gained experience from being the treasurer of the Oceanography Club. 

 

Parliamentarian – Brenna McGowan

Brenna is a third-year History and Anthropology double major with a Spanish minor, from Kennett Square, PA. She is the current Parliamentarian for SGA, and in the past has held the position of Curriculum and Academic Policies Senator. Outside of SGA, Brenna is an Off-Campus and Commuter Services Commuter Assistant. 

 

Public Relations Officer – Jasmine Stewart

Jasmine is a first-year Statistics major with a minor in Accounting from Lancaster, PA. She currently serves as the University Libraries Senator where she started the Student Library Advisory Board. Her other involvement on campus include the Accounting Society and the Center for Community Solutions.

About the Student Government Association

The Student Government Association is an inclusive student organization looking to project student concerns and bridge the gap between students and administrations. SGA is hard at work revising our bylaws and holding themselves accountable for abiding by them. 

 

The goal of the SGA is to provide a unified and responsible government that will promote the welfare and growth of students and for students. The SGA will work to ensure that all rights and privileges are shared by all. The SGA will make certain that the concerns of students are heard and acted upon.
